    3. John Strom came from Germany about 1750, settled i n Northampton, he had 3 sons, John, Andrew, and Frederick, Andrew Strom the great-great-grandfather of Dr. William J. Strorm (subect), had 3 children, among whom was a son, John Teel, our subject's great-grandfather married Rachel Learn and they had children, Jacob, Andrew, Peter, Samuel, Charles, John and Elizabeth. Heller,William, (born 1836) subject, a native of Monroe Co., the s/o James and Rachel (Keller) Heller, was born in Chestnut Hill township, the latter the d/o C. D. Keller. The father of William, was a native of Hamilton townnship and a son of David and Elizabeth Heller James Heller, father of William, had 11 children,his 5th child, Mary, married Jacob Learn. Anglemeyer, Peter, subject was born Sept 20, 1843, he married in 1874 to Emma Woodling, d/o John and Lydia (Learn) Woodling. Shafer, Peter W., was born in Hamilton township, June 10, 1843, a son of Jacob and Christiana (Saylor) Shafer, the former of Monroe County, the latter of Northampton. His paternal grandfather, James Shafer, was in Hamilton township in 1820, moved to Cattaragus, NY. The father stayed in Monroe Co. He died in 1878, their Thomas married Florence Learn and they lived in Cuba, NY. The paternal grandparent of our subject. Samuel Spragle, were George and Sophia (LaBar) Spragle, natives of Lancaster and Monroe Counties Both died in the latter. Children, Jacob, father of subject Daniel, Geolrge, John, Peggy the wife of ___ Carmer,Fanny the wife of George Learn, Mary the wife of Joseph Learn, Elizabeth who married ____ Miller. The daughters all became residents of Cattaraugus, NY. Our subject's maternal grandfather, John Lewis Myers, was a native of Germany, came to America and in 1775 located in Monroe (then Northampton Co) Co. Best Wishes, Geri
